Kirk & Kirk is a British eyewear brand founded by Jason and Karen Kirk, known for its colourful and bold frames designed to make a statement. Each frame is made with high-quality materials and is available in various styles, colours, and sizes to suit different face shapes and personal tastes. Kirk & Kirk has won numerous awards for its innovative designs and attention to detail - they are available in optical shops worldwide and online at Pretavoir. You will also see them worn by celebrities and influencers such as Robert Downey Junior, Young Thug, and Jim Parsons.

Jason and Karen Kirk come from a family with a rich history of pioneering optics. Their grandfather and great-uncle, Sidney and Percy Kirk, founded Kirk Brothers in 1919 after converting an old sewing machine into a lens cutter. The family-owned business quickly gained a reputation for innovative frame designs and business practices, such as introducing the first adjustable nose pads and delivering frames by motorbike courier. Today, Jason and Karen Kirk continue to build on the family legacy with Kirk & Kirk, creating innovative and adventurous eyewear.

Kirk & Kirk Glasses

 

Kirk & Kirk is a brand committed to its core values, reflected in the way they design and construct glasses. Karen Kirk is inspired by the endless sculptural possibilities of bespoke materials as she hand designs each frame with great attention to detail, drawing inspiration from jewellery and mid-century glass. The brand has developed its acrylic that offers a unique colour palette, allowing them to create lightweight and comfortable frames that won't lose adjustment or stretch over time. The frames also feature German five-barrelled hinges and integral nose pads for strength and comfort. Kirk & Kirk glasses are constructed in one factory in France, remaining true to the brand's roots and crafting modern ideas using authentic, traditional methods.
